Melting Pot Series
Inspired by the intersection of food and life.
It’s about taking a lighthearted approach to the injustice and pain I feel when I see how some people treat those who are different than themselves.
My love of food and curiosity in visual language lead me to a study of color, texture, and forms inspired by food—Mix them up as if they are different people. Arranging materials, colors, forms, and compositions to invoke contrast and harmony. The idea of duality where love and hate coexists.
Flow Series
The fluidity of watered down paint and the texture of pastels, reminiscent of my time at the beach. Building water dams and tiny castles. It's a spiritual practice traveling down to memory lane with my mom, dad, and sister. Water and sand, the most basic form that keeps me in the flow.
Hope Series
Inspired by my family and friends touched by cancers. This series is my interpretation of our vulnerability, strength, and resilience. A celebration of life full of hope, an expression of fear turned into courage and love.
